Transaction 38abd08e7388648f6fcc1cae4c493d09cc1c00382feef1bafc743469e75158e9
1 Input
2 Outputs
- 38abd08e7388648f6fcc1cae4c493d09cc1c00382feef1bafc743469e75158e9:0
- 38abd08e7388648f6fcc1cae4c493d09cc1c00382feef1bafc743469e75158e9:1
value 1341989
address 1MmRCBJshJEVQE4egJKHEDZiNAUYNdzjyX
value 11847895
address 1JVGVox6zqEgviagguuV3ThMzcZZ6PwRcy